Lewis Hamilton is targeting a first Ferrari pole position (Reuters)Formula 1 heads to Barcelona for the renamed Barcelona-Catalunya Grand Prix this weekend and round seven of the 2026 F1 season. Life could not be better for Kimi Antonelli right now. In Monaco, he claimed his fifth consecutive victory with a dominant lights-to-flag performance after claiming a stunning pole position. His lead in the world championship is now 66 points.Lewis Hamilton is now Antonelli’s closest contender after finishing second in Monte-Carlo, a fortnight after finishing second in Canada. The 41-year-old is showing his best form in Ferrari colours, but is still chasing that elusive first grand prix win. As for George Russell, it was another frustrating weekend as he finished outside of the points after a late drive-through penalty. (Getty)Kieran Jackson13 June 2026 14:50McLaren's Lando Norris: "We're up there with the people we want to be with," he said after topping FP2 on Friday."It's hot and I don't think anyone's going to be that happy."It's difficult with the wind and with the conditions but it seems to be working better than the last few weeks, which is a good sign."Lando Norris (Reuters)Kieran Jackson13 June 2026 14:40Kieran Jackson13 June 2026 14:28Christian Horner suffers F1 return delay as Renault Group says ‘no discussions’Christian Horner has suffered a dent in his Formula One comeback bid after the boss of the Renault Group which controls Alpine said there are currently “no discussions” with the former Red Bull team principal.Horner is exploring a way back to the paddock after he was sacked by Red Bull following last July’s British Grand Prix.Alpine confirmed earlier this year that Horner, 52, was among a group of investors interested in acquiring Otro Capital’s 24 per cent shareholding in the Enstone team. Renault Group owns the other 76 per cent in Alpine.More detail below: Kieran Jackson13 June 2026 14:10Kimi Antonelli on a tricky practice"The tyres are overheating quite a lot," said Antonelli on Friday."Just trying to find the best balance.
